Output 102995c181a6d394111b06a0088e6a2ed4fefa67b742539f96d579909bb78559:58

value
6741233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18cfb168f572ea6dba6d4bdc36a70a3b01d77cc4 OP_EQUAL
address
MAAMFoCL6D18zhrzeFqgKSGq32NhbF2SDu
transaction
102995c181a6d394111b06a0088e6a2ed4fefa67b742539f96d579909bb78559
spent
true